              32 years in the trade …… This is a little tip that may save you a lot of time taking your drain apart under your bathroom sink if it has a mechanical drain. Not all mechanical drains are made like this, but there are thousands that are. The drain on your basin is called a Poplug. It stands for patented overflow. remember if you have to use a plunger to unplug your basin drain; you must plug off the overflow with a damp rag in order for the plunger to due the job properly. This works 9 out of 10 times. I hope this helps…. Please subscribe and have a good day.

                    Jewelry Down The Drain?

                    How to do-it-yourself instructional on retrieving jewelry or other valuables lost down the drain. Alright, today on Repairs101 I’m going to show you what you can do if you’ve gone and dropped a valuable piece of jewellery down the kitchen sink — or any other sink, for that matter. I’ll show you a couple of possibilities. Alright, I’ll try and keep this as quick as I can and apologies for the static camera angle. Let’s do a little zoom in and see what we can do to make this a little more interesting. OK. Here on your left there is a sink. Just above my head here is another sink. We have some down pipes, some elbows. Here’s a water trap, comes up and joins the tee junction that joins the two down pipes from the two sinks and here’s another drain from the dishwasher right there. Dishwasher right here drains through this hose right here and just tees into this pipe right here, again through the tee junction into the water trap or elbow pipe, if you prefer, and out through the wall and down into the sewers. So you’re going to need a container like a bucket to catch the water that’s going to come out of this. You might be lucky and you might have some new plastic pipes like this that are easy enough to just crack by hand and you don’t even need any tools but… There are a lot of options available to you, as far as what you can use to open up that elbow joint.
